    If you are familiar with Middle Eastern culture, you are aware of the close-knit nature of families, which provide opportunities for safety, employment, and marriage prospects. In today's Gospel, Jesus tells his disciples that to follow him, they must give up their families, which can be a heavy cross. He is asking them to give up everything, which breaks the social norms.

    This hasn't changed in 2,000 years: He is asking us to not live of this world, just in it.

    Gospel: Luke 14:25-33
